Output af5696c72b0f1ef874fbb3024ad3c83b03eba51d89ebf2cdf5daddc23fe40552:1

value
23067888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999357e26b7aa640fc7d5975bf967f0337ee2293 OP_EQUAL
address
3Fh3pV84dNEfDhU7faLrhUZCDxHdfQZCUG
transaction
af5696c72b0f1ef874fbb3024ad3c83b03eba51d89ebf2cdf5daddc23fe40552
spent
true